Output 88bd9d626dcfc33f9a9c938e93f7b8c3b3e94de88a579a059dfa4683bf890ec2:2

value
753044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4a3cccee6e0a8209b5fa944938b51b1958e6dc OP_EQUAL
address
32zaKLkt1iB6QcXrmUHMWRrLGYtCYKunJD
transaction
88bd9d626dcfc33f9a9c938e93f7b8c3b3e94de88a579a059dfa4683bf890ec2
confirmations
345179
spent
true